Загрузка в grub, когда Ubuntu установлен только в режиме Legacy
Моя ОС Ubuntu работает только на моей машине, если я включил режим Legacy и отключил безопасную загрузку. И я никогда не загружаюсь личинкой. Я просто хочу спросить, как сначала загрузиться в grub, так как я планирую выполнить двойную загрузку с другой ОС в режиме Legacy, а также потому, что режим UEFI делает мою машину непригодной к использованию, поскольку это указывает на отсутствие загрузочных устройств.
1 ответ
В стандартной установке Ubuntu вы используете GRUB 2, даже если вы этого не понимаете. В некоторых случаях (например, установка только в Ubuntu) меню GRUB 2 может не отображаться, но GRUB 2 работает. Без GRUB 2 или другого загрузчика ядро Linux не может загрузиться, поэтому Ubuntu не будет работать.
(Обратите внимание на предостережение "некоторого другого загрузчика". LILO, GRUB Legacy, SYSLINUX, ELILO и загрузчик-заглушки EFI - все альтернативные загрузчики, которые будут выполнять работу GRUB [более или менее]. Ни один из них не установлен и не настроен как загрузчик по умолчанию, хотя.)
Если вы установите Windows после установки Ubuntu, загрузчик Windows начнет процесс загрузки и, вероятно, загрузится прямо в Windows. Чтобы восстановить GRUB 2, вам нужно будет использовать Boot Repair с аварийного диска или переустановить GRUB 2 (или другой загрузчик) вручную.
Также обратите внимание, что на современном компьютере использование BIOS/CSM/ устаревшего режима делает это нелегко. Посмотрите эту страницу, чтобы узнать, почему это так. Скорее всего, вы установили в режиме BIOS, потому что вы подготовили загрузочный носитель неправильно, хотя это может быть другая проблема, которая отправила вас по этому пути. В любом случае у вас есть два варианта:
- Преобразование в установку в режиме EFI путем преобразования диска из MBR в форму GPT (необязательно, но настоятельно рекомендуется) с
gdisk
(подробности см. здесь) и установка загрузчика в режиме EFI. Затем вы можете отключить CSM и установить Windows в режиме EFI. - Установите Windows в режиме BIOS. Многие старые учебные пособия описывают, как это сделать и как восстановить GRUB 2, как только вы закончите, но у меня нет удобного URL. Имейте в виду, что вы можете случайно загрузить установщик Windows в режиме EFI, и в этом случае он, скорее всего, будет жаловаться на таблицу разделов MBR на вашем диске (при условии, что это то, что у вас есть). Если вы столкнетесь с этой ошибкой, вы можете либо конвертировать Ubuntu для загрузки в режиме EFI, как в предыдущем пункте, либо научиться управлять процессом загрузки, чтобы установщик Windows загрузился в режиме BIOS.